スキーマ:

DATA_SHARING_USAGE

LISTING_TELEMETRY_DAILY ビュー

DATA_SHARING_USAGE スキーマの LISTING_TELEMETRY_DAILY ビューには、データ交換とリージョンごとに日次のテレメトリデータが表示されます。このビューは、組織内の各データ交換とそのデータ交換が利用可能な各リージョンの行を返します。

列名

データ型

説明

EXCHANGE_NAME

VARCHAR

Snowflake Marketplace など、リストが属するData Exchangeの名前。

EVENT_DATE

DATE

イベントの日付。

SNOWFLAKE_REGION

VARCHAR

イベントが発生したSnowflake Region。 NONE の場合は、Snowflakeアカウントにサインインしていないユーザーに対してイベントが発生しました。

LISTING_NAME

VARCHAR

リストの識別子。

LISTING_DISPLAY_NAME

VARCHAR

リストの表示名。

LISTING_GLOBAL_NAME

VARCHAR

リストのグローバル名。各リストで一意であり、リスト URL を作成するために使用されます。

EVENT_TYPE

VARCHAR

リストで発生したイベント。ACTION 列と組み合わせて使用します。これは、次のいずれかになります。

  • GET: コンシューマーは、 ACTION 列の値に応じて、無料、有料、または限定トライアル掲載用のデータベースを作成するか、 Snowflake Native App をインストールします。

  • REQUEST: コンシューマーはデータをまだ利用できないリージョンで限定トライアルリスト、または無料リストをリクエストします。

  • LISTING CLICK: ユーザーは、検索や Snowflake Marketplace ページからのリストのタイルをクリックします。

  • LISTING VIEW: ユーザーは、リストの詳細ページにアクセスします。

  • UNINSTALL: コンシューマーは Snowflake Native App をアンインストールするか、インポートしたデータベースをドロップします。

ACTION

VARCHAR

イベントに対して実行されたアクション。これは、次のいずれかになります。

  • STARTED: コンシューマーは、リストの詳細ページで、リストの Get または Request を選択しました。

  • COMPLETED: EVENT_TYPE に応じて、次のいずれかである可能性があります。

    • EVENT_TYPE が GET の場合、コンシューマーが Snowflake Native App をインストールしたこと、またはデータ製品からデータベースを作成したことを示します。有料および限定トライアルのリストの場合、これはコンシューマーがトライアルを開始したか、データ製品を購入したことを示します。

    • EVENT_TYPE が REQUEST の場合、プロバイダーがコンシューマーからリスト要求を受信したことを示します。

    • EVENT_TYPE が UNINSTALL の場合、コンシューマーが Snowflake Native App を正常にアンインストールしたか、インポートされたデータベースを正常にドロップしたことを示します。

  • CLICK: LISTING CLICK イベントの場合、検索または Snowflake Marketplace ホームページなどから、コンシューマーがリストのタイルをクリックしたことを示します。

  • VIEW: LISTING VIEW イベントの場合、リストビューを記録します。

EVENT_COUNT

INTEGER

このイベントアクションがイベント日に発生した合計回数。

CONSUMER_ACCOUNTS_DAILY

INTEGER

上記の特定のイベントアクションを実行した、個別のアカウントの数。

CONSUMER_ACCOUNTS_28D

INTEGER

過去28日間に特定のイベントアクションを実行した、個別のコンシューマーアカウントの数。

REGION_GROUP

VARCHAR

コンシューマーのアカウントがある リージョングループNONE の場合は、Snowflakeアカウントにサインインしていないユーザーに対してイベントが発生しました。

使用上の注意

  • ビューの待機時間は最大2日間です。

  • データは365日間(1年間)保持されます。

  • ビューには、データ製品が Snowflake Native App であろうと共有であろうと、すべてのデータ商品のデータが含まれます。

各リストのクリック率を確認するには、次のコマンドを実行します。

SELECT
  listing_name,
  listing_display_name,
  event_date,
  SUM(IFF(event_type = 'LISTING CLICK', consumer_accounts_daily, 0)) AS listing_clicks,
  SUM(IFF(event_type IN ('GET', 'REQUEST') and action = 'STARTED', consumer_accounts_daily, 0)) AS get_request_started,
  SUM(IFF(event_type IN ('GET', 'REQUEST') and action = 'COMPLETED', consumer_accounts_daily, 0)) AS get_request_completed,
  get_request_completed / NULLIFZERO(listing_clicks) AS ctr
FROM snowflake.data_sharing_usage.LISTING_TELEMETRY_DAILY
GROUP BY 1,2,3
ORDER BY 1,2,3;
Copy

当面の潜在顧客からのリストビュー数をより明確に把握するには、 REGION_GROUP フィールドを使用して、ビューがSnowflakeアカウントにサインインしたユーザーによって実行されたかどうかで、1日あたりのリストビューの合計カウントを分割することができます。

SELECT
  listing_name,
  listing_display_name,
  event_date,
  COUNT_IF(event_type= 'listing_view' AND region_group='NONE') as unknown_user_view_count,
  COUNT_IF(event_type= 'listing_view' AND region_group!='NONE') as known_user_view_count
FROM snowflake.data_sharing_usage.LISTING_TELEMETRY_DAILY
GROUP BY 1,2,3
ORDER BY 1,2,3;
Copy